About the piece
Created around 1895, this painting represents Paul Cézanne's mature style as he explored the abandoned Bibémus Quarry near Aix-en-Provence. The work highlights his transition toward Modernism, using rhythmic, block-like brushstrokes to define the terracotta-colored sandstone cliffs and the verdant foliage, creating a composition that emphasizes the underlying structure of the natural world.
